Warning Signs You Need Retail Store Water Damage Restoration

Don’t ignore these warning signs, they can show a more serious issue that needs prompt attention. If you notice any of these signs, don’t hesitate to call our team for help.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can show the presence of mold or mildew. If you notice a musty smell in your retail store, it’s essential to investigate further. Our team can help you detect and remove any hidden moisture that may be causing the odor.

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Water stains can be a sign of a more serious issue, such as a burst pipe or a roof leak. If you notice water stains on your walls or ceilings, don’t delay, call our team to assess the damage and develop a plan to fix it.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age or structural issues.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s essential to investigate further. Our team can help you detect and repair any damage to your flooring.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ks

Unusual sounds or leaks can show a more serious issue, such as a burst pipe or a roof leak. If you notice any unusual sounds or leaks in your retail store, don’t delay, call our team to assess the damage and develop a plan to fix it.

Visible Signs of Mold or Mildew

Visible signs of mold or mildew can show a more serious issue that needs prompt attention. If you notice any visible signs of mold or mildew, don’t hesitate to call our team for help.

Retail Store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water stain on the ceiling Yes No You can likely fix it yourself with a simple repair kit.
Burst pipe in the basement No Yes A burst pipe needs specialized equipment and expertise to fix safely and efficiently.
Water damage from a storm No Yes Storm-related water damage often needs specialized equipment and techniques to fix safely and efficiently.
Visible signs of mold or mildew No Yes Mold and mildew need specialized equipment and expertise to remove safely and prevent further growth.
Water damage to electrical systems No Yes Water damage to electrical systems needs specialized equipment and expertise to fix safely and prevent electrical shock.
Water damage to structural elements No Yes Water damage to structural elements needs specialized equipment and expertise to fix safely and prevent further damage.

Retail Store Water Damage Restoration Cost In Scituate, MA

The cost of Retail Store Water Damage Restoration in Scituate, MA, var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a customized estimate for your specific situation. Here are some typical price ranges for different aspects of Retail Store Water Damage Restoration: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, amount of water removed
Cleaning and sanitizing $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, level of contamination
Repair and re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, level of damage
Mold remediation $1,500 – $6,000 Size of affected area, level of contamination
Electrical system repair $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of damage, complexity of repair
Structural repair $2,500 – $10,000 Severity of damage, complexity of repair

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ates to help you understand the costs involved.

Common Questions About Retail Store Water Damage Restoration

Q: What causes water damage in retail stores?

A: Water damage in retail stores can be caused by a variety of factors, including burst pipes, roof leaks, flooding, and storm damage. It’s essential to have a plan in place to prevent and respond to water damage. Our team can help you develop a customized plan to protect your retail store from water damage.

Q: How long does Retail Store Water Damage Restoration take?

A: The length of time it takes to complete Retail Store Water Damage Restoration depends on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a customized estimate for your specific situation. In general, we can complete Retail Store Water Damage Restoration within 3-5 days.

Q: Is Retail Store Water Damage Restoration covered by insurance?

A: Yes, Retail Store Water Damage Restoration is often covered by insurance. But, the specifics of your policy will depend on the terms and conditions of your coverage. Our team can help you navigate the insurance process and ensure that you receive the compensation you deserve.

Q: How can I prevent water damage in my retail store?

A: There are several steps you can take to prevent water damage in your retail store, including regular maintenance and inspections, installing flood-proof doors and windows, and using water-resistant materials in construction.
